Average Insider

Where insiders trade, we follow

52W Low$16.47
Current$21.2376.4% above low, 23.6% below high
Sale$15.94-8.5% above low, 108.5% below high
52W High$22.70
Shares
2,917,500
Price
$15.94
Total Value
$46,497,656.25

Nearby Earnings

No earnings within 2 weeks of this transaction.

Transaction Details

InsiderDavis Jennifer Lynn
TitleDirector
Transaction DateFeb 13, 2026
Transaction CodeS Sale
Acquired/DisposedDisposed
Security
Common Stock
Direct/IndirectIndirect
Nature of OwnershipSee Footnotes.
Filing DateFeb 13, 2026
Document DateFeb 13, 2026
Shares Sold2,917,500
Price per Share$15.94
Total Value$46,497,656.25
Shares Owned After95,370,751
DerivativeNo
Accession Number0001193125-26-051522
DocumentView SEC Filing
Version: v26.3.23